
J2EE实例详解:Duke应用深入解析与案例研究

### 知识点详解
#### J2EE经典例子详解
##### 标题分析
标题中的"J2EE 经典例子详解(1-347全!)"表明这是一本专注于J2EE(Java 2 Platform, Enterprise Edition)技术的书籍或教程,涵盖了大量的例子,从1到347个进行全方面的解析。这里所指的"全"可能意味着它提供了从基础到高级的大量实例,帮助读者全面掌握J2EE。
##### 描述分析
描述部分提供了对书籍内容的介绍,包括以下几个关键点:
1. **Duke应用实例**:Duke是Java的吉祥物,这里提到的Duke应用实例很可能是使用Java技术的一个代表性的示例程序,通过这个实例,读者可以学习到如何使用J2EE技术进行企业级应用开发。
2. **由远及近和自底向上的分析方法**:这种方法强调了学习的过程,从宏观的角度逐渐深入到具体的细节,有助于读者逐步建立起知识框架,并在理解了基础知识之后,深入到更复杂的技术细节中。
3. **源代码逐块解释**:通过对源代码的逐块分析,使读者能够理解每一个代码片段的作用,这对于编程学习者来说至关重要,因为实际编程能力的提升离不开对代码的深入理解。
4. **体系结构、设计模式、框架构件的介绍**:这一部分是理论知识,介绍了J2EE中的重要概念,包括如何构建系统架构,使用合适的设计模式以及如何利用各种框架构件来简化开发工作。
##### 标签分析
标签"J2EE例子 J2EE例子讲解 J2EE实例 J2EE实例讲解"进一步证实了这个文档是关于J2EE技术的实际例子和详细的讲解。标签强调了文档的实际应用和实践性,以及对J2EE技术的深入阐释。
##### 压缩包子文件的文件名称列表分析
文件列表000241.pdg、000240.pdg、000245.pdg、000247.pdg、000255.pdg、000250.pdg、000253.pdg、000251.pdg、000252.pdg、000235.pdg看起来像是书籍的电子版页面,.pdg格式通常用于表示便携式文档图形格式,可能是扫描版的书籍页面。如果想要阅读这些文件,需要有对应的PDF阅读器或者转换工具来打开。
#### J2EE技术详解
J2EE是Java平台企业版的缩写,是Java技术中用于开发企业级应用的一套规范。J2EE定义了一整套用于开发、部署和管理Internet和企业内部网应用程序的规范。其核心概念包括:
1. **多层架构**:J2EE支持多层架构,典型的有表现层、业务层、持久层等,这种分层的结构有助于更好的组织代码,分担任务。
2. **分布式计算模型**:J2EE支持分布式计算,应用程序组件可以分布在网络的不同节点上,通过远程方法调用(RMI)或Web服务等方式进行通信。
3. **事务管理**:企业应用往往涉及到大量数据处理,J2EE提供事务管理,确保数据的一致性和完整性。
4. **消息服务**:JMS(Java Message Service)提供了在不同组件之间传递消息的机制,对于异步处理和解耦合提供了支持。
5. **安全性**:J2EE定义了一套安全机制,包括认证、授权、数据加密等,以保证企业应用的安全性。
6. **连接性**:J2EE支持通过JDBC(Java Database Connectivity)连接到不同的数据库系统。
7. **J2EE容器**:容器是J2EE应用服务器的核心部分,它负责管理组件的生命周期,提供如事务管理、安全服务等公共服务。
8. **设计模式**:为了实现应用中的可复用性和灵活性,J2EE鼓励使用设计模式,如MVC(模型-视图-控制器)模式。
9. **框架构件**:J2EE定义了多种服务和构件,如Servlet用于处理HTTP请求,EJB(Enterprise JavaBeans)用于实现业务逻辑等。
10. **开发和部署工具**:J2EE提供了一整套开发和部署工具,包括集成开发环境(IDE),应用服务器等,大大简化了企业级应用的开发和部署过程。
通过对J2EE相关知识点的学习,可以更好地理解企业级应用的开发需求和方法,结合书籍提供的Duke实例,可以更加深入地掌握和应用这些知识。
相关推荐










yooooyiiiiiiiiii
- 粉丝: 13
最新资源
- Java初学者到高手的进阶秘籍
- 基于Access数据库的公司人力资源管理系统
- C++网络编程双册指南:深入掌握ACE模式与框架
- JSP技术实现的多用户留言本系统功能介绍
- 使用VC源码列举本机TCP网络连接控制台程序
- C++性能优化技巧:提升编程效率的实用指南
- Linux常用命令快速入门指南
- 深入学习Java Swing程序设计指南
- 深入掌握Visual C++.NET Part B教程
- 大型软件公司.NET面试题深度解析
- 深入理解Java设计模式:常用模式全面解析
- Java游戏编程的黑艺术深度解读
- 朱朱相册源程序v3.0:高效管理与展示个人或公司作品集
- 42天掌握英语的高效短文学习法
- Visual C++.NET 入门教程详解(第一部分)
- 贪吃蛇游戏升级:J2ME MIDlet开发与动画显示
- 俄罗斯rxlib275-D5控件库详细介绍
- 键盘上弹奏钢琴旋律的模拟器应用介绍
- 掌握C#设计模式:23种模式详解与实例应用
- Struts, Spring, Hibernate整合实战教程
- 探索FreeJava编译器:Java开发者的便捷选择
- JSP打造的全功能下载系统推荐
- 在线人数统计系统开发教程(Asp.net+SqlServer)
- 同普网络相册源代码:功能丰富与安全设计